The AMAP Assessment Architecture: How It Is Supposed to Work
AMAP is one of six working groups established under the Arctic Environmental Protection Strategy, which was folded into the Arctic Council at its founding in 1996 via the Ottawa Declaration. Its mandate is specific: monitor and assess threats to the Arctic environment, with a focus on pollution, climate, and contaminants. AMAP does not set policy. It produces assessments designed to be policy-relevant without being policy-prescriptive — a distinction that matters when the assessments are cited in negotiations over emissions standards, shipping regulations, or fisheries management.
The assessment production cycle follows a recognizable pattern. A steering group, typically co-chaired by representatives from two Arctic Council member states, defines the scope. Lead authors are nominated by national contact points. Drafting proceeds in chapters, each assigned a lead author team. The first draft undergoes expert review — comments are logged, adjudicated by lead authors, and archived. A second draft is produced, reviewed by member states and permanent participants, and the comments are again adjudicated. A final draft goes to the Senior Arctic Officials for approval. The executive summary is the only part requiring formal SAO approval; the underlying chapters are accepted but not approved, a convention borrowed from the IPCC to separate scientific findings from political sign-off.
This architecture worked when the assessment cycle aligned with the two-year chairship rotation and when all eight member states participated in the expert networks. It is breaking down now for reasons that are partly political, partly physical, and partly institutional.
The 2025 Short-Lived Climate Forcers Assessment: What Was at Stake
Short-lived climate forcers — methane, black carbon, tropospheric ozone — are pollutants whose atmospheric lifetimes range from days to roughly twelve years. They matter disproportionately in the Arctic because black carbon deposited on snow and ice accelerates melting, and because methane emissions from permafrost thaw and offshore sources create feedback loops that conventional climate models still struggle to parameterize. The AMAP assessment was designed to update the 2015 and 2021 reports with new observational data, including satellite-derived methane plume measurements from the Permian Basin and the Yamal Peninsula, and improved transport modeling from the Norwegian Institute for Air Research.
The assessment’s policy relevance was clear. The Arctic Council’s Expert Group on Black Carbon and Methane had been waiting for updated data to inform its recommendations to member states. The International Maritime Organization’s Sub-Committee on Pollution Prevention and Response had referenced AMAP’s prior black carbon findings in its discussions on heavy fuel oil regulation under MARPOL Annex I. The 2025 assessment was supposed to provide the evidentiary base for the next round of regulatory discussions. The Russian Co-Chair Absence: What It Means for Data Integrity
Since the Arctic Council’s partial resumption of work in 2022 — after the pause triggered by Russia’s invasion of Ukraine — Russian experts have not participated in AMAP’s assessment work. Russia’s territory accounts for roughly half of the Arctic’s landmass and the majority of its known methane sources, including the West Siberian petroleum basin and the East Siberian Arctic Shelf. Russian observational data from ground stations at Tiksi, Samoylov Island, and Ambarchik had been integral to prior AMAP assessments. The 2025 assessment had to rely on satellite data and modeled emissions to fill gaps previously covered by Russian in-situ measurements.
This is not merely a data quality problem. It is an institutional authority problem. AMAP assessments derive credibility from the consensus of all eight Arctic states — a consensus that implies no participating government can dismiss the findings as incomplete or politically skewed. With Russia absent, the assessment carries an asterisk the institution has not formally acknowledged. The executive summary states that data coverage for the Russian Arctic is limited. It does not state what that limitation means for confidence intervals on the assessment’s key findings, nor does it address the implications for the Arctic Council’s claim to produce assessments representing the full circumpolar region.
The absence also affects the review architecture itself. AMAP’s expert review process depends on a network of reviewers nominated by national contact points. Without Russian reviewers, the assessment’s treatment of Russian data sources — including the critical question of whether satellite-derived methane measurements over the Yamal Peninsula are consistent with declining production reported by Novatek — went through thinner review than any prior AMAP climate assessment. The lead authors did their best. The problem is structural, not personal.

The Review-Comment Adjudication Process as Institutional Infrastructure
The mechanics of how AMAP handles review comments deserve scrutiny because they are the mechanism protecting the assessment’s credibility. Every review comment is logged in a structured database. Each is assigned a unique identifier, linked to the specific passage in the draft it addresses, and routed to the lead author team for the relevant chapter. Lead authors must respond to every comment — accepting, rejecting, or partially accepting — and the response is recorded alongside the comment. If a comment is rejected, lead authors must provide a written justification. The full comment-response log is archived and, in principle, available to anyone who challenges the assessment’s findings.
This adjudication architecture has a direct precedent in the IPCC’s own review procedures, which AMAP’s founding documents explicitly cite as a model. The IPCC’s prescribed two-round expert and government review process — codified in its Appendix 3 procedures — was designed precisely to prevent the kind of executive-summary drift that occurs when first-round findings survive into the final document without the second-round challenge that catches data-integration errors and cross-chapter inconsistencies. The IPCC learned this lesson the hard way after the Himalayan glacier error in its 2007 Fourth Assessment Report, which entered the summary for policymakers through a first-round citation that second-round review would have caught. The institutional response was to strengthen the review-comment adjudication log and require that every comment — including rejected ones — carry a traceable written justification archived for external audit. AMAP adopted a parallel procedure. The 2025 climate forcers assessment bypassed it.

What the Next Cycle Should Do Differently
The Danish chairmanship, which assumed the Arctic Council rotation in 2025, has an opportunity to address the structural problem rather than repeating it. Three specific changes would reduce the risk of another compressed review cycle producing an assessment whose executive summary does not fully reflect its underlying science.
First, AMAP’s procedures should be revised to decouple the assessment timeline from the chairship calendar. The current practice of aligning assessment delivery with ministerial meetings creates a structural incentive to compress review when the science is not ready. Assessments should be released when the review process is complete, not when the political calendar demands a deliverable. This would require the SAOs to accept that some chairships will produce more assessment deliverables than others — a political cost, but one lower than the cost of a credibility deficit.
Second, the assessment’s executive summary should carry a structured uncertainty annex — a one-page table mapping each key finding to its confidence level, data sources, and review status. This annex would make the gap between the executive summary and the underlying chapters visible to policymakers who will never read the chapters. It would also create an institutional record of what was reviewed and what was not, preventing the corrigendum problem from recurring silently.
Third, the Danish chairmanship should formalize a protocol for assessments produced without full eight-state participation. The protocol would require the executive summary to state explicitly which data regions are underrepresented, what the confidence implications are, and how the assessment should be cited by downstream regulatory bodies. This would replace the current footnote approach — which buries the limitation in technical language — with a standardized disclosure that the IMO, CLRTAP, and national agencies can interpret consistently.
